Tuscan Glade 4

Dulux

The Analysis

Tuscan Glade 4 is a light, sage-leaning green that reflects a good amount of light thanks to its LRV of 61.63. Because it sits in the mid-range of brightness, it prevents a room from feeling washed out while simultaneously making smaller spaces feel open and connected to the outdoors.

This is an excellent main wall colour for living areas or bedrooms. It acts as a subtle, sophisticated neutral that doesn't demand too much attention, allowing your furniture and decor to define the room’s character.

How to Use It

It pairs beautifully with light oak or walnut wood tones and matte black hardware for a sharp, modern contrast. Use it in kitchens or sunrooms to amplify natural daylight, but ensure you test it in your specific light, as it can occasionally pick up cool undertones.

Colour harmonies

Complementary

Opposite on the colour wheel — bold, high-contrast pairings. Use for a feature wall or furniture you want to command attention.

Analogous

Neighbouring hues — cohesive and calm, great for layered schemes that feel collected rather than matched.

Split complementary

Near-opposites for strong contrast with a little less tension than a pure complement. A favourite of interior designers.

Triadic

Three evenly spaced hues — balanced, vibrant, and versatile. Keep one dominant and use the others sparingly.

Tetradic (square)

Four hues in a square on the wheel — rich, dynamic palettes. Best when one colour leads and the others accent.

Monochromatic

Dark, mid, and light steps on the same hue — a failsafe gradient for trim, walls, and accents without shifting colour family.
